ATS-Optimized for US Market

Lead React Development: Crafting Scalable Solutions & Driving Innovation for Web Applications

In the US job market, recruiters spend seconds scanning a resume. They look for impact (metrics), clear tech or domain skills, and education. This guide helps you build an ATS-friendly Principal React Specialist resume that passes filters used by top US companies. Use US Letter size, one page for under 10 years experience, and no photo.

Expert Tip: For Principal React Specialist positions in the US, recruiters increasingly look for technical execution and adaptability over simple job duties. This guide is tailored to highlight these specific traits to ensure your resume stands out in the competitive Principal React Specialist sector.

What US Hiring Managers Look For in a Principal React Specialist Resume

When reviewing Principal React Specialist candidates, recruiters and hiring managers in the US focus on a few critical areas. Making these elements clear and easy to find on your resume will improve your chances of moving to the interview stage.

  • Relevant experience and impact in Principal React Specialist or closely related roles.
  • Clear, measurable achievements (metrics, scope, outcomes) rather than duties.
  • Skills and keywords that match the job description and ATS requirements.
  • Professional formatting and no spelling or grammar errors.
  • Consistency between your resume, LinkedIn, and application.

Essential Skills for Principal React Specialist

Include these keywords in your resume to pass ATS screening and impress recruiters.

  • Relevant experience and impact in Principal React Specialist or closely related roles.
  • Clear, measurable achievements (metrics, scope, outcomes) rather than duties.
  • Skills and keywords that match the job description and ATS requirements.
  • Professional formatting and no spelling or grammar errors.
  • Consistency between your resume, LinkedIn, and application.

A Day in the Life

The day begins with stand-up, reviewing progress on critical React components and addressing any roadblocks junior developers might be facing. I then dive into code reviews, ensuring adherence to coding standards and performance best practices. A significant portion of my time is dedicated to architecting new features, collaborating with UX/UI designers and product managers to define requirements and translate them into elegant, efficient React code. This often involves using tools like Redux, Context API, or MobX for state management and libraries like Material UI or Ant Design for component styling. Regular meetings are held with the infrastructure team to optimize deployment pipelines using CI/CD tools like Jenkins or GitLab CI. By the end of the day, I ensure all code is well-documented and pushed to the repository using Git, ready for integration into the next release cycle, while also mentoring junior React developers.

Career Progression Path

Level 1

Entry-level or junior Principal React Specialist roles (building foundational skills).

Level 2

Mid-level Principal React Specialist (independent ownership and cross-team work).

Level 3

Senior or lead Principal React Specialist (mentorship and larger scope).

Level 4

Principal, manager, or director (strategy and team/org impact).

Interview Questions & Answers

Prepare for your Principal React Specialist interview with these commonly asked questions.

Describe a time you had to make a difficult technical decision regarding React architecture. What were the tradeoffs, and how did you arrive at your decision?

Hard
Technical
Sample Answer
In a previous project, we were faced with the decision of using Redux versus Context API for state management in a complex React application. Redux offered a centralized store and predictable state management, but introduced more boilerplate code. Context API was simpler but might lead to performance issues with frequent updates. After careful consideration and benchmarking, we opted for Redux due to the size and complexity of the application, prioritizing maintainability and scalability over initial development speed. This ensured a more robust and manageable codebase in the long run, despite the initial overhead.

Tell me about a time you mentored a junior developer struggling with a React concept. What approach did you take?

Medium
Behavioral
Sample Answer
I recall a junior developer struggling with understanding React hooks. Instead of simply providing the solution, I first tried to understand their current grasp of the topic. Then, I broke down hooks into simpler components, demonstrating how they replaced class components and solved common problems. I used real-world examples from our project to illustrate the benefits and walked them through the process of refactoring a class component to use hooks. I emphasized the importance of understanding the underlying principles rather than just memorizing syntax, encouraging them to experiment and ask questions. We also paired on a small feature utilizing hooks.

How would you approach optimizing the performance of a slow-rendering React component?

Medium
Technical
Sample Answer
Optimizing slow-rendering React components involves several strategies. First, I'd use the React Profiler to identify the bottleneck. Then, I'd explore techniques like memoization using `React.memo` or `useMemo` to prevent unnecessary re-renders. If the component fetches data, I'd optimize data fetching using techniques like pagination or lazy loading. For complex calculations, I'd consider using web workers to offload processing to a separate thread. Finally, I'd ensure efficient rendering by avoiding unnecessary prop drilling and using virtualization for large lists. The goal is to minimize re-renders and optimize data handling for a smoother user experience.

Describe a situation where you had to advocate for a specific technology or architectural approach in a project. What was your reasoning, and how did you persuade others?

Hard
Situational
Sample Answer
In a previous project, I advocated for adopting TypeScript over plain JavaScript for a large-scale React application. My reasoning was that TypeScript's static typing would improve code maintainability, reduce runtime errors, and enhance developer productivity. To persuade others, I presented a clear comparison of the benefits and drawbacks, highlighting the long-term advantages of TypeScript in terms of code quality and scalability. I also conducted a pilot project to demonstrate the practical benefits and address any concerns. By providing evidence-based arguments and addressing stakeholder concerns, I was able to gain buy-in and successfully implement TypeScript in the project.

Explain your experience with testing React components. What testing frameworks and methodologies are you familiar with?

Medium
Technical
Sample Answer
I have extensive experience testing React components using various frameworks, including Jest, React Testing Library, and Cypress. I'm familiar with different testing methodologies, such as unit testing, integration testing, and end-to-end testing. For unit testing, I use Jest and React Testing Library to test individual components in isolation. For integration testing, I use React Testing Library to test the interaction between components. For end-to-end testing, I use Cypress to simulate user interactions and verify the application's functionality. I also emphasize the importance of writing comprehensive test suites to ensure code quality and prevent regressions.

How do you stay up-to-date with the latest trends and best practices in React development?

Easy
Behavioral
Sample Answer
I stay up-to-date with the latest trends and best practices in React development through a variety of channels. I regularly read articles and blog posts from reputable sources like the React official blog, Medium, and Dev.to. I follow key influencers and thought leaders in the React community on Twitter and LinkedIn. I attend conferences and webinars to learn about new technologies and techniques. I also actively participate in online forums and communities like Stack Overflow and Reddit to exchange knowledge and learn from others. Finally, I experiment with new technologies and frameworks in personal projects to gain hands-on experience and deepen my understanding.

ATS Optimization Tips

Make sure your resume passes Applicant Tracking Systems used by US employers.

Tailor your resume to each job description. Use keywords that match the job requirements to increase your chances of getting past the ATS.
Use a chronological format for your work experience section. ATS systems generally prefer this format for parsing information.
Clearly label each section with standard headings. Use terms like "Skills," "Experience," "Education," and "Projects."
Use a simple font like Arial, Calibri, or Times New Roman. Avoid using decorative or unusual fonts that may not be recognized by the ATS.
Quantify your accomplishments whenever possible. Use numbers, metrics, and percentages to demonstrate the impact of your work.
Include a skills section with both technical and soft skills. List specific programming languages, frameworks, and tools that you are proficient in.
Save your resume as a PDF file. This ensures that your formatting is preserved when the resume is uploaded to the ATS.
Use action verbs to describe your responsibilities and accomplishments. Start each bullet point with a strong action verb to highlight your contributions.

Common Resume Mistakes to Avoid

Don't make these errors that get resumes rejected.

1
Listing only job duties without quantifiable achievements or impact.
2
Using a generic resume for every Principal React Specialist application instead of tailoring to the job.
3
Including irrelevant or outdated experience that dilutes your message.
4
Using complex layouts, graphics, or columns that break ATS parsing.
5
Leaving gaps unexplained or using vague dates.
6
Writing a long summary or objective instead of a concise, achievement-focused one.

Industry Outlook

The US job market for Principal React Specialists is highly competitive, driven by the increasing demand for dynamic and scalable web applications. Companies are actively seeking experienced professionals who can not only build robust front-end solutions but also lead development teams and drive innovation. Remote opportunities are prevalent, allowing specialists to work for companies across the country. Top candidates differentiate themselves through a strong portfolio of complex projects, deep understanding of React architecture, and proven leadership abilities. Staying current with the latest React updates, best practices, and related technologies like TypeScript and GraphQL is crucial for success.

Top Hiring Companies

NetflixMetaAmazonGoogleMicrosoftSalesforceStripeCoinbase

Frequently Asked Questions

What is the ideal resume length for a Principal React Specialist in the US?

For a Principal React Specialist with extensive experience, a two-page resume is generally acceptable. Focus on showcasing your most relevant and impactful achievements, emphasizing leadership experience, architectural design skills, and specific React projects. Use concise language and quantify your accomplishments whenever possible. Highlight your expertise with key technologies like React, Redux, Node.js, and TypeScript. Prioritize recent roles and accomplishments, and tailor your resume to each specific job application.

What key skills should I highlight on my Principal React Specialist resume?

Highlight your principal expertise with React, including advanced knowledge of its core principles, architecture, and best practices. Emphasize your experience with related technologies like Redux, Context API, TypeScript, GraphQL, and Node.js. Showcase your leadership skills, project management abilities, and communication skills. Also, demonstrate experience with testing frameworks like Jest and Cypress, and CI/CD pipelines using tools like Jenkins or GitLab CI. Don't forget to mention experience with cloud platforms like AWS or Azure.

How can I optimize my resume for Applicant Tracking Systems (ATS)?

To optimize for ATS, use a clean and simple resume format without tables, images, or unusual fonts. Use standard section headings like "Summary," "Experience," "Skills," and "Education." Incorporate relevant keywords from the job description throughout your resume, especially in the skills section and job descriptions. Save your resume as a PDF to preserve formatting. Ensure your resume is easily readable by parsing software, and avoid headers, footers, and text boxes.

Are certifications important for a Principal React Specialist resume?

While not always mandatory, certifications can enhance your credibility and demonstrate your commitment to professional development. Consider certifications related to React, JavaScript, or related technologies like AWS Certified Developer or Microsoft Certified Azure Developer. Certifications related to Agile methodologies (e.g., Scrum Master) can also be beneficial, especially in leadership roles. Highlight any relevant certifications prominently on your resume, including the issuing organization and date of completion.

What are common resume mistakes to avoid as a Principal React Specialist?

Avoid generic resumes that lack specific details about your accomplishments and contributions. Don't use vague language or buzzwords without providing concrete examples. Avoid listing irrelevant skills or experience that are not related to the job description. Proofread your resume carefully to eliminate typos and grammatical errors. Ensure your resume is visually appealing and easy to read. Do not exaggerate your skills or experience, as this can be easily detected during the interview process. Forgetting to quantify your accomplishments is a critical mistake.

How can I highlight a career transition on my Principal React Specialist resume?

When transitioning into a Principal React Specialist role, emphasize transferable skills and relevant experience from your previous roles. Highlight projects where you demonstrated leadership, problem-solving, and communication skills. Showcase your ability to learn new technologies quickly and adapt to changing environments. Consider including a brief summary statement explaining your career transition and highlighting your motivation for pursuing a career as a Principal React Specialist. Focus on the value you can bring to the role based on your unique background and experience. Mention how your experience with related frameworks and tools can be leveraged.

Ready to Build Your Principal React Specialist Resume?

Use our AI-powered resume builder to create an ATS-optimized resume tailored for Principal React Specialist positions in the US market.

Complete Principal React Specialist Career Toolkit

Everything you need for your Principal React Specialist job search — all in one platform.

Why choose ResumeGyani over Zety or Resume.io?

The only platform with AI mock interviews + resume builder + job search + career coaching — all in one.

See comparison

Last updated: March 2026 · Content reviewed by certified resume writers · Optimized for US job market